Networking

除了 iptables,我的 IP 還能在哪裡被阻止?

  • April 16, 2017

在我無法從我的永久 ip SSH 進入遠端機器後,我在遠端機器上執行了以下程式碼塊:

(
sudo apt-get purge denyhosts
sudo apt-get purge fail2ban
sudo apt-get autoremove
sudo sh /etc/csf/uninstall.sh
sudo apt-get install --reinstall openssh-server -y
sudo apt-get install --reinstall iptables -y
sudo iptables -F.
sudo reboot
)

然而,我仍然無法從我的永久 IP SSH 到我的遠端電腦(與埠 21 和 22 相比,埠 80 對我的永久 IP 開放,我可以毫無問題地通過它訪問我的網站和 PHPmyadmin)。

注意:我可以從其他 IP 地址 SSH 我的遠端機器沒有問題。

我假設我的個人永久 IP 在我的遠端電腦中被部分阻止(至少對於埠 21 和 22),但我不知道它被阻止在哪裡。程式碼塊包括重新安裝 iptables(我什至嘗試通過 完全刪除它apt-get purge iptables)但我仍然被部分阻止。

我的問題是,除了 iptables,我的 ip 還能在哪裡被限製或阻止?

在 SSHD 配置本身(通常是/etc/ssh/sshd_config)、TCPWrappers 中(通常是/etc/hosts.allow/etc/hosts.deny)以及確保 SSH 守護程序實際執行的其他一些區域。這不是一份詳盡的清單,但如果我處於這種情況,我接下來要檢查的事情。

引用自:https://unix.stackexchange.com/questions/359204